Severn Tunnel Junction station is well-equipped for all traveler needs. With ticket machines that are accessible, travelers can easily purchase and collect their tickets purchased online. However, bear in mind that no ticket office may be staffed outside of its opening hours, which are early morning to late morning on weekdays.
Accessibility is a key focus at this station. Step-free access is available across the entire station including to all platforms via a footbridge with ramps, making it user-friendly for families with buggies or travelers with mobility challenges. Although waiting rooms are not available, there is a comfortable seating area where passengers can wait for their trains.
Car parking is ample with more than 100 spaces available, six of which are reserved for those requiring accessible parking. Plus, it's all free! CCTV ensures added security for vehicles left in the station's car park which operates 24 hours daily.
The station provides diverse onward travel options, making it a convenient hub for exploring the greater region. Located directly inside the station's car park is the rail replacement bus stop, crucial for continued travel during those rare instances when trains are unavailable. Although no cycle hire services exist, the station fares well for cyclists with secure housing for bicycles, complete with CCTV monitoring.

Hatfield (Herts) station is equipped to handle all your ticket purchasing needs, with a ticket office open from early morning to night every day of the week. Accessible ticket machines are available and cater to passengers with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Additionally, smartcards can be issued and validated here, simplifying your journey further. You'll find an induction loop for hearing assistance and CCTV throughout for your safety and peace of mind.
For those moments when you need a quick refreshment or a little retail therapy, the station offers a selection of shops and refreshment facilities, along with an ATM for quick cash needs. While there isn’t a waiting room office, there is seating available, and though there are no accessible toilets, standard ones are conveniently located by the waiting area.
Inclusivity is a priority at Hatfield (Herts), which boasts step-free access across the entire station, categorizing it as a Category A station. For passengers requiring assistance, a staff-operated ramp is available, and staff are on hand to help from the first to the last train of the day. An assistance meeting point can be found on platform 1, ensuring everyone travels comfortably and easily.
